An Advanced Skill Certificate in Drug Design Optimization Techniques equips participants with the advanced computational and experimental methods essential for modern drug discovery. This intensive program focuses on optimizing lead compounds for improved efficacy and reduced toxicity, crucial aspects of pharmaceutical development.
Learning outcomes include mastery of molecular modeling, pharmacophore modeling, quantitative structure-activity relationship (QSAR) analysis, and high-throughput screening techniques. Students will gain hands-on experience using industry-standard software and databases, improving their skills in cheminformatics and medicinal chemistry.
The duration of the certificate program is typically 6-12 months, depending on the institution and course intensity. This allows for in-depth study and project-based learning, culminating in a substantial research project focused on drug design optimization.
